In 1878, Mary Sorrell entered the world in Montana, USA, born to Isaac Sorrell And Therese Quit T Nbi Michel Quit T Ni. In 1900, Mary Sorrell resided in Flat Head Indian Reservation, Missoula, Montana, U. Mary Sorrell married William John Finley, and had children including Gabriel Finley, James Oliver Finley, John Finley, Lucy Finley, Martin Finley, Virginia Margaret Finley. Mary Sorrell passed away in 1943 in Saint Ignatius, Lake, Montana, USA.
